Great Peninsula Conservancy (GPC) is a 501(c)(3) nonprofit land trust dedicated to protecting the natural habitats, rural landscapes, and open spaces of the Great Peninsula region of West Puget Sound, Washington. GPC’s important work is accomplished through conservation, stewardship, and community engagement. GPC’s Land Labs Program provides students from Title I schools with hands-on conservation education. The program promotes academic engagement through outdoor learning and introduces students to a wide variety of STEM professions with family sustaining salaries. In this way, Land Labs supports AmeriCorps VISTA’s poverty alleviating mission. Land Labs lessons take place in outdoor classrooms where youth learn about ecological land management, restoration, conservation science, and career opportunities in these fields.
